François MAROIS was born 24 April 1694 in Château-Richer, Canada, New France . François MAROIS was the child of Guillaume MAROIS and Catherine LABERGE and the grandchild of: (paternal) Charles MARIOS and Catherine LIVRADE (maternal) Robert LABERGE and Françoise GAUSSE dite LEBORGNE
Marriage(s) and Child(ren):
He married Marie-Anne HÉBERT 27 January 1716 in L'Ange-Gardien, Montmorency, Canada, New France . The couple had (at least) 8 children. Marie-Anne HÉBERT was born 21 February 1697 in L'Ange-Gardien, Montmorency, Québec, Canada. She died 10 April 1741 in L'Ange-Gardien, Montmorency, Québec, Canada. She was the daughter of Guillaume HÉBERT dit LECOMTE and Marie-Anne ROUSSIN.
François MAROIS died 11 December 1759 in Charlesbourg, Québec, Canada, New France .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
